WebIn September 1921, Hemingway married Hadley Richardson. Later that year he took a job with the Toronto Daily Star as their European correspondent. Hemingway and his bride soon relocated to Paris, to a primitive apartment with no running water, with a rented room nearby where Hemingway could work in peace. WebDec 18, 2015 · Ernest Hemingway lived in Toronto on two separate occasions. His first stay in Toronto was between January and June of 1920, while staying with the Connables.
